abbiamo già 2 nuovi kernel per stupix, scritti in basic.
questo fa pensare ad una possibile implementazione di stupix come ambiente operativo sul commodore64.
kernel proposto da giorgio-fox:
10 GOTO 10
20 END.
modifica da me proposta:
10 END.
20 END.
30 END.
40 PRINT "LA PEGURA LA CANTA"
StupiX: Se Tu lo Usi Potresti Incazzarti Xtremamente.
"37 Goga di trock dovrebbero essere abbastanza per chiunque..."
kernel stupix 2 la vendetta
ecco una possibile mia versione VB di stupix
sub Visualizza()
'Questa procedura visualizza una simpatica schermata blu che emula Windows
Form.backcolor = VBblue
Randomize
Label1.caption = "Si è verificato un'errore irreversibile all'indirizzo " & Int((60000 * Rnd) + 1) & " x " & Int((60000 * Rnd) + 1) & ". Stupix verrà brutalmente riavviato!!! (pensa alla salute)"
end sub
sub Form_click()
on errore go to Gestione
Call Visualizza()
Gestione: call Visualizza()
end sub
sub Form_click()
msgbox "Se riesci a leggere questo messaggio puoi ritenerti fortunato!",,"Errore"
call Visualizza()
end sub
sub command1_click()
select case text1.text
case 1
call Visualizza()
case 2
unload me
case 3
end
case else
call visualizza()
end select
end sub
<font size=4></font id=size4>
Una gallina incontra una papera e le chiede : "Dove abiti?" "Qua"
sub Visualizza()
'Questa procedura visualizza una simpatica schermata blu che emula Windows
Form.backcolor = VBblue
Randomize
Label1.caption = "Si è verificato un'errore irreversibile all'indirizzo " & Int((60000 * Rnd) + 1) & " x " & Int((60000 * Rnd) + 1) & ". Stupix verrà brutalmente riavviato!!! (pensa alla salute)"
end sub
sub Form_click()
on errore go to Gestione
Call Visualizza()
Gestione: call Visualizza()
end sub
sub Form_click()
msgbox "Se riesci a leggere questo messaggio puoi ritenerti fortunato!",,"Errore"
call Visualizza()
end sub
sub command1_click()
select case text1.text
case 1
call Visualizza()
case 2
unload me
case 3
end
case else
call visualizza()
end select
end sub
<font size=4></font id=size4>
Una gallina incontra una papera e le chiede : "Dove abiti?" "Qua"
- gdeber
- GranGianGnomo
- Messaggi: 1547
- Iscritto il: 13 set 2001, 10:40
- Località: Rivolta d'Adda
- Contatta:
dopo lunga e attenta analisi, il team di sviluppo di stupix ha deciso che la programmazione ad alto livello (se così si può chiamare) causa dei groosi_rallentamenti a tutto il sistema, per cui, secondo la notissima politika, è stato deciso di iniziare la progettazione di un kernel completamente scritto in asm. ecco la prima versione:
begin :
mov ax,0h
mov bx,0h mov eax, 1234h
mov eax, ebx
hlt
nop
loop:
nop
loop loop
mov ah,4ch
int 21h
end.
comunque il loop perde il pelo ma non il vizio.
***L'assembler è alla base dell'universo®***
begin :
mov ax,0h
mov bx,0h mov eax, 1234h
mov eax, ebx
hlt
nop
loop:
nop
loop loop
mov ah,4ch
int 21h
end.
comunque il loop perde il pelo ma non il vizio.
***L'assembler è alla base dell'universo®***
Ecco qual era l'idea:
Bisognerebbe creare un programma che emuli la pressione dei tasti Ctrl+Alt+Canc.
Questo programma poi si deve attivare a suo piacimento. Per far questo bisogna implementare (Bianchetti ti amo) le suguenti procedure che scriverò in metalinguaggio:
<b>
Funz 1
</b>
PalleGirate: Carica il programma un numero elevatissimo di volte perché il sistema ha le palle girate.
<b>
Funz 2
</b>
VogliaDiCazzeggiare: il sistema non ha voglia di lavorare e suggerisce all'udente (utente) di spegnere il computer, se l' u-dente non ascolta il consiglio, viene attivata la procedura AutoEspulsione (già descritta), dopo di che chiama l'emulazione suddetta.
<b>
Funz 3
</b>
CazzoQuantoÈSimpaStupix
Funzione che emula la pressione dei tre tasti (Ctrl+Alt+Canc) e successivamente comunica tramite una serie di messaggi a video, le barzellette ce si possono leggere via wap dal cellulare del berto® (o da qualsiasi altro telefono)<font face='Trebuchet MS'></font id='Trebuchet MS'><font face='Script MT Bold'></font id='Script MT Bold'>
Una gallina incontra una papera e le chiede : "Dove abiti?" "Qua"
Bisognerebbe creare un programma che emuli la pressione dei tasti Ctrl+Alt+Canc.
Questo programma poi si deve attivare a suo piacimento. Per far questo bisogna implementare (Bianchetti ti amo) le suguenti procedure che scriverò in metalinguaggio:
<b>
Funz 1
</b>
PalleGirate: Carica il programma un numero elevatissimo di volte perché il sistema ha le palle girate.
<b>
Funz 2
</b>
VogliaDiCazzeggiare: il sistema non ha voglia di lavorare e suggerisce all'udente (utente) di spegnere il computer, se l' u-dente non ascolta il consiglio, viene attivata la procedura AutoEspulsione (già descritta), dopo di che chiama l'emulazione suddetta.
<b>
Funz 3
</b>
CazzoQuantoÈSimpaStupix
Funzione che emula la pressione dei tre tasti (Ctrl+Alt+Canc) e successivamente comunica tramite una serie di messaggi a video, le barzellette ce si possono leggere via wap dal cellulare del berto® (o da qualsiasi altro telefono)<font face='Trebuchet MS'></font id='Trebuchet MS'><font face='Script MT Bold'></font id='Script MT Bold'>
Una gallina incontra una papera e le chiede : "Dove abiti?" "Qua"